    How many people have seen the 'new' "Our Promise" signs?

    I say new, because it seems they have just put a big sticker over the r+r bit and written "double the difference of the error made there instead.

    I visited a store recently that had all the huge "Our Promise" signs manually altered, and the checkout signs (the little white ones saying what credit/debit cards they accept) had all have little white film put across the part of the sign which says about r+r..

    Be on the lookout!

    I suppose there are circumstances where "Double the Difference" may be better. Say some fruit has been marked down from 99p to 19p but you're charged full price. Before you would have got 99p back, now you'd get £1.60.
    However, it's not going to help much with a £20 overcharge on an XBox.

    I've still seen nothing to state that this is official corporate policy though.
